Bat Masterson arrives in a chaotic tent‑city where a gang of wranglers is stealing horses. An old flame begs Bat to save her fiancé, who has been falsely accused of murder and is about to be lynched by the victim’s vengeful brother.
Bat Masterson wins the contract of a young boxer from his crooked manager, then trains him for one honest fight—betting all his poker winnings on the kid. The former manager refuses to allow a fair match and sets up a scheme to ensure the fighter loses, forcing Bat to intervene.
